The Evening Standard reports that actor Adam Deacon has been sectioned under the Mental Health Act.
Deacon was due to appear at Thames Magistrates’ Court today after being charged with affray and possession of a long bladed sword, in an incident that took place near his home in Bethnal Green earlier this year.
The Kidulthood star did not appear at Thames Magistrates’ Court this morning because he was too unwell after being sectioned under the Mental Health Act, the hearing was told.
The hearing was adjourned to 30 April.
Deacon will also stand trial at Hammersmith Magistrates Court on May 11th, accused of harrassing actor/director Noel Clarke.
